Amazon says that starting April 10, 2026, Amazon Luna will no longer offer game stores, individual game purchases, or third-party subscriptions. Previously purchased titles and Bring Your Own Library access remain available only through June 10, 2026, while Ubisoft+ and Jackbox Games subscriptions sold through Luna are also being discontinued.

Pearl Abyss has detailed the first major Crimson Desert post-launch roadmap in its April 9, 2026 Dev Update. Boss Rematches, Re-blockading, easy/normal/hard difficulty settings, character skill changes, and broad storage and control improvements are set to roll out between April and June.

Phoronix reports that Valve developer Natalie Vock has assembled kernel and KDE-side work to give foreground games priority on limited video memory. The early goal is less spillover into system RAM and steadier Linux gaming on common 8GB cards.
Funcom says more than 80% of lifetime players have stayed in PvE content, driving a split between PvE and PvP Deep Desert instances. The same April 2026 update also outlines self-hosted servers with customizable settings, transfer rules, and substantial setup requirements.
